    Regional Medical Advisor - Diabetes

    The Positions

    As a RMA, you will be Contribute actively to building and maintaining scientific understanding of NN marketed products in Diabetes by sharing up-to-date medical knowledge and clinical trial data with internal and external stakeholders, and leveraging scientific and clinical expertise to create relationships with Key Opinion Leaders (KOLs), Healthcare Professionals (HCPs) and other healthcare decisions makers.

    Your main accountabilities will be:

    • Scientific support for marketed products and development projects within therapeutic areas guided by business needs.
    • Productive relationships with key stakeholders and relevant institutions/organizations to achieve competitive advantage and market leadership within therapeutic areas. Acting as a scientific ambassador for Novo Nordisk, ensuring that the profile of the company remains high amongst key stakeholders through establishing a peer-to-peer relationship based on scientific rigor and integrity.
    • Training and educational activities for clinicians and other HCPs working and supporting and training for sales teams.
    • Delivery of scientific information to HCPs, Drug Formulary Committees, and Expert Groups. Specific medical project leadership and responsibility. Plan and align HCP and Key Opinion Leader (KOL) engagement planning with the brand event calendar. Medico-marketing support for product campaign development & implementation.
    • Driving and organizing advisory boards, HCP interactions and other KOL engagements. Developing and presenting scientific information to external audiences – HCPs, KOLs etc.

    Moreover, you will be contributing to the generation of new data relevant to the product/portfolio assigned; and identifying and critically evaluating new data and using the data for effective communication purposes.  You will foresee and proactively address potential scientific challenges and ensure that external communications conform to regulatory laws and directions.

    Qualifications

    You hold Min. bachelor’s degree in natural sciences, healthcare, or an advanced degree in health sciences. Medical degree or pharma degree is most preferred.  As well as you will have, excellent command of both written and spoken English and have a relevant business background. Having proven experience creating targeted content is advantageous. Moreover, you have:

    • Minimum 2 years of pharmaceutical experience in Medical Affairs. Previous experience in diabetes or metabolic disease area preferred, however willingness to learn and progress in diabetes therapy area most important.
    • Strong stakeholder engagement, communication, and presentation skills can provide recommendations despite uncertainty and pressure and are able to handle and simplify complexity while focusing on the bigger picture.
    • You are a team player, but at the same time possess independent drive, and have a can-do mindset. Good at translating medical/scientific insights to business opportunities/implications.
    • Proven success in strong leadership and interpersonal skills and a structured and transparent way of working. Ability to manage complex tasks/processes and organizational issues.
    • Experience and willingness to work in an international matrix organization. Ability and willingness to quickly adjust to new situations in a continuously developing environment.
